Thessaly, Larissa AR Drachm. Early-mid 4th century BC. Head of the nymph Larissa facing slightly left, grain ears in hair / mare in foreground, foal in background standing right; in exergue ΛΑΡΙΣΑΙΩΝ. BCD Thessaly II 294. 5.41g.
Near Very Fine; encrustations. Rare.
